About Retirement Law in Zakynthos, Greece:

Retirement in Zakynthos, Greece, is regulated by specific laws and regulations that govern the rights and obligations of retirees. These laws cover issues such as pension benefits, retirement age, healthcare, and social security. Understanding these laws is crucial to ensuring a smooth transition into retirement.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What is the retirement age in Zakynthos, Greece?

The standard retirement age in Zakynthos, Greece, is typically around 65 years old, but this can vary depending on the specific circumstances and profession.

2. What are the types of pension benefits available in Zakynthos, Greece?

There are various types of pension benefits available in Zakynthos, Greece, including old-age pensions, disability pensions, survivor's pensions, and more.

3. How can I ensure my pension benefits are protected?

To ensure your pension benefits are protected, it is essential to stay informed about the latest retirement laws and regulations, regularly review your pension plan, and seek legal advice if you encounter any issues.

4. What healthcare benefits are available to retirees in Zakynthos, Greece?

Retirees in Zakynthos, Greece, are entitled to healthcare benefits through the national health system, which covers a range of medical services and treatments.

5. Can I work part-time during retirement in Zakynthos, Greece?

Yes, it is possible to work part-time during retirement in Zakynthos, Greece, but this may affect your pension benefits, so it is essential to understand the implications before making any decisions.

6. How can a lawyer help with estate planning for retirement?

A lawyer can assist with estate planning for retirement by helping you create a will, establish trusts, minimize estate taxes, and ensure your assets are distributed according to your wishes.
